Referral Coordinator I CareMore Health Management Services, LLC Long Beach, CA Job Details Full-time $20.70 - $31.05 an hour 1 day ago Qualifications High school diploma or GED Full Job Description Job Description Summary ‎ About the Role The Referral Coordinator I processes routine referrals and supports authorization activities while meeting quality and productivity standards. ‎ How will you make an impact & Requirements ‎ Primary Responsibilities Initiates and processes routing clinical referrals and authorization requests following established procedures. Serves as a liaison between hospital, health plans, physicians, patients, vendors and other referral sources to support referral coordination. Reviews referrals for completeness and accuracy and follows up for additional information if necessary. Verifies insurance coverage and initiates pre-authorization requests in accordance with payer requirements and established workflows. Responds to inbound requests related to referral processing while meeting productivity and quality standards. Contacts physician offices as needed to obtain demographic information or related data. Enters referrals, documents communications, actions and related information in system. Escalates complex referral issues or authorization concerns to senior referral coordinators or leadership as appropriate. Minimum Qualifications High school diploma or GED and minimum of 1 year of customer service or healthcare administrative experience required; or any combination of education and experience which would provide an equivalent background. Medical Assistant certificate / certification from an accredited training program required . Knowledge of medical terminology, plan specific guidelines; ICD-9 and CPT coding preferred. ‎
